The hexadecimal color code #6022CD corresponds to the code RGB( 96, 34, 205 ). It's a shade of Purple. This color is a combination of red (at 0,38 level), green (at 0,13 level) and blue (at 0,80 level). Its brightness is 46% and its saturation is 71%. It is composed of red at 28%, green at 10% and blue at 61%. The dominant component is blue.
